In this example, the heat from burners Conduction is the process of heat being transferred between objects through direct contact, and it's the most common type of heat transfer. For example, in cooking the burners on stoves will conduct heat energy to the bottom of a pan sitting on top of it. From there, the pan conducts heat to its contents. Heavier (denser) components will fall, while lighter (less dense) components rise, leading to bulk fluid movement. Due to the resistance in the burner, the current causes the burner to heat up (just like any resistor warms up when you send current through it, due to collisions caused by the charges trying to move through the material in the resistor). Because the water molecules have much more freedom to move around than do the stove and pot molecules, the faster-moving water molecules at the bottom of the pot can now begin transferring their kinetic energy to the rest of the water via both conduction and convection.
